Service · Outcome Discovery
A 5–10 working-day paid planning phase before a new product, major development or high-risk technology decision.
Why is it necessary?
We clarify which problem is worth solving and what outcome defines success. A Discovery does not necessarily end in Build — the decision workshop can just as well end in Stop, and that is a full-value result.

What we need from you
A named contact who also owns the decision.
2–3 short conversations with the key people, in the first week.
Access to existing documentation, data and systems, where they exist.
If these are delayed, the elapsed time slips; the number of working days does not change.
